Also, I'm not sure if her ass can handle more than an hour on that passenger saddle. The human body is a very versatile thing. Start with some 30 mins rides, then some 60, then 90, etc... You'll be amazed how comfortable it will feel once you condition your/her body to get used to it. I've ridden 135 miles of single track in a day on this: http://www.fizik.it/saddles/mtb-saddles/tundra-m1/ It might not look too comfortable and certainly has no padding, but I could have gone longer if necessary (well, my butt could have haha, not so sure about my legs!). That saddle is the most comfortable saddle I have ever ridden and as long as they keep making them, that's my go-to. I guess my point is that it's really got little to do with the amount of padding. It's more about getting your body used to it. Life is good on 2 wheels!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
